Every time The Ding Dongs play a rock show I get to also make a show poster.

Here is the poster I designed for this show.

Mike Votava and The Ding Dongs at The Sunset Show Poster

I went minimal with this one using not very much text and only a few colors. The tallish display font pairs well with the tall white “cliff” on the right side. The vignette texture around the edges adds a spotlight effect, which helps draw the eye to the text at the center of the page.

The flaming marble texture against the red background adds depth and an element of danger as if the background is erupting. Speaking of danger, what could be more dangerous than a crazy death-defying Vespa jump across a gorge?

I used three different images to composite the final design.

Image #1: A photo of some dudes standing on a cliff. (credit Unsplash)

This photo terrifies me. I can’t believe those dudes are standing that close to the edge of that cliff. Seems like a bad idea. What if a big gust of wind comes along and blows them off the side?

I only used the “cliff” shape in my poster design. The rest of the photo I threw in the trash. Didn’t need it.

My original idea for the design concept was to keep it more photorealistic and add in some collage-like elements.  The cliff and the background were going to look about the same, but  I was going to replace the standing dudes with something more exciting like a ninja battle or a wrestling match. I fiddled with that idea for a bit before I changed my mind. I couldn’t quite get it to work.
